NOTES FOR PREPARING THE BOE FOR A FLOWER SHOW ACHIEVEMENT AWARD:

Maximum of 20 pages total (10 pages if printed on both sides).

Legible print and uncrowded spacing.

Follow the order of the “Evaluation Form for NGC Flower Show Achievement Award”.

Photographs and text inserted into text boxes are easily arranged in the document.

Evidence of quality exhibits, creative staging, overall unity, and special features important.

Required photographs: Top Exhibitor Award Winners in all divisions; Theme staging overall;

Actual staging in each Division and Section; Special Features

SHOW DESCRIPTION - “A DAY AT THE ZOO”

The fun theme of this NGC Standard Flower Show inspired 95% member participation. Life-sized giraffes built by members towered to the Lemon Bay clubhouse roof at the entrance. The porch featured a zoo ticket window with a “Free Today” sign. Guests enjoyed popcorn and lemonade while strolling the club gardens. The zoo theme was carried through the schedule titles, the custom show logo, signage, and staging.

The Design Division of 3 Sections, 36 entries included classes of Petite, Invitational and Functional Tables, and Creative Design types as well as a Novice Class to encourage participation by members who had never entered a flower show. Exhibits were staged on rectangular tables and pedestals draped in black fabric by the Committee. The exhibits in one of the three petite classes were displayed on the wall under a “jungle tree”.

The Horticulture Division included 18 Sections, 201 entries. Cut Horticulture (125) exhibits were staged inside the clubhouse on tiered tables draped in black fabric and on a long counter-height cabinet faced with zebra print fabric. Container-grown horticulture exhibits (76) were staged on wooden benches in the shade house. Boxes wrapped in zebra print were used to elevate exhibits.

Education Division exhibits (4) staged on tables draped in black fabric showcased NGC objectives. Botanical Arts Artistic Crafts Exhibits (3 Classes, 12 entries) were staged on a bamboo screen, a tiered table draped in black fabric or a black velvet oval.

All 14 NGC Top Exhibitor Awards offered were awarded.

Classes from a local elementary school exhibited invitational horticulture. Framed student

drawings of favorite zoo animals were displayed in the garden gazebo - “GaZoobo Gallery”.

A plant sale was held during the show. Hundreds of plants propagated by members and zoo animals painted on palm spathes were sold to supplement the club flower show budget.

NOTE FOR PHOTOGRAPHS OF AWARD WINNERS:

List Division, Section, Class, brief description and NGC Award/s. No local/club awards. Ideally photograph horticulture award winners in front of a staging panel or blank wall. Not necessary to include ribbons or entry cards in photographs. Omit people from photographs if possible. Insert photos into text boxes to place where needed.

PUBLICITY Pre-show publicity included articles in both local newspapers, the Englewood Sun and the Englewood Review. There were posts on the Club and District web sites, the club Facebook page, and the Chamber of Commerce billboard. An e-mail flyer was sent to all District club presidents and to club members for further distribution. Over 500 flyers were handed out at the Englewood Farmer’s Market on the two market Thursdays before the show.

Post-show publicity in the Englewood Sun included a glowing description of the show and a list of all awards with

exhibitor names. The Englewood Review featured a photograph of the blue-ribbon Club Novice Award winner with

her Exhibition Table Design.

NOTES FOR PUBLICITY PAGES OF THE BOE: INCLUDE COPIES OF PUBLICITY DOCUMENTS: There should be a minimum of one kind of pre-show publicity. Local (City/County) newspaper publicity preferred but not required. Publicity following the show could also be included. Examples: Flyers, posters, screenshot of Facebook page, scripts/schedules from a radio/TV broadcast. Include source name and date/s. Document may be photographed and inserted into a text box. Documents may be reduced in size to fit on the page.
